Beth, you should find out from the listing agent if there have been any other offers recently OR if the bank has done any recent appraisals or BPO's (Broker's Price Opinions). If that has happened then you offer will need to be in line with what the bank see's as the value of the home. If there has not been any offers then you may feel free to find what comparable homes are selilng for in the area and submit something within an acceptable range. You may want your buyers agent to do a BPO to justify the offer price with recent home sales and ask that it be submitted to the lender as part of your offer. Good luck.
